Russian Research Team Proposes New Method for Studying Morphology of Flexible Crystals

Russian Research Team Proposes New Method for Studying Morphology of Flexible Crystals

Experts from the Siberian Circular Photon Source Collaboration Center and the Institute of Solid State Chemistry and Mechanochemistry of the Siberian Branch of the Russian Academy of Sciences have proposed a comprehensive method for studying the morphology of flexible organic crystals. The method combines computational algorithms, laboratory microscopy techniques, and experimental diffraction studies, and can be used to more reliably determine crystal geometry and facet arrangement. The results have been published in the Journal of Applied Crystallography. Flexible crystals are a relatively rare class of organic crystals that can bend under very small mechanical stress while maintaining lattice integrity.
